Transaction 809126a2d7ec953e481ab311b4bec8e59ba52f6b896d4357ea7f08d5d4ec40ca

1 Input
1 Outputs
  • 809126a2d7ec953e481ab311b4bec8e59ba52f6b896d4357ea7f08d5d4ec40ca:0
  • value  678956
    address  3HUbAo1rVYqCSXHf2JMLmRwycYRtmpDHDq